Ticket: PLAT-0042 — Expired credential causing cold-start failures in Snowline handlers

Summary for review: the Snowline serverless handlers fetch their config from the Hearthvault service during cold starts. The credential baked into the deployment bundle expired last night, so every cold start now fails authentication while warm instances continue serving. The fix in this PR replaces the bundled credential with the rotated one and adds an expiry check at build time. For verification, the new key is below.

service key, tadup-tahog: zpat7_wB1tnEL

MEMO — For the incoming director

Re: Legacy pricing, Vantrel platform

Legacy customers on Vantrel contracts remain 18–22% below current list. Increase scheduled for next renewal cycle: 8% year one, 6% year two. Notification letters drafted; legal has cleared the wording. Expect churn of roughly 4%, concentrated in the smallest accounts. Support scripts updated. Objection-handling training booked. The underlying plan is summarised below.

confidential, kagep-kahof: Druokax Systems plans to lower the Ulaath list price by 53 percent in March.

## Environments — Quillhopper Service

Quillhopper runs serverless handlers in three environments: dev, staging, and prod. Cold starts in prod average 1.8s because the handler pulls the rules bundle at init; staging keeps a warm pool of two instances to mask this. If cold-start latency regresses, check the bundle size first. Each environment overrides the provisioned-concurrency and timeout settings, and prod currently uses the following values:

deployment values, kajep-kageg:
[praix]
host = praix.paliqcorp.corp
user = praix_svc
database = praix_prod